Transaction 723c155e60e8c005d714d005da2c49bb2436377353cb153a8dbd620ffc0806b7

3 Input
2 Outputs
  • 723c155e60e8c005d714d005da2c49bb2436377353cb153a8dbd620ffc0806b7:0
  • value  6090572
    address  39dX99hHisMRp6vEVEWAoKqJU9R7ehNVRM
  • 723c155e60e8c005d714d005da2c49bb2436377353cb153a8dbd620ffc0806b7:1
  • value  960719
    address  12wGNhFymQ8Qh86XyKatQjcWaeWudwKn9x